Basic (or pure) sociology - Answer- sociological research for the purpose of making
discoveries about life in human groups, not for making changes in those groups
Applied Sociology - Answer- the use of sociology to solve problems from classroom
integration and family relationships to crime and pollution
Public Sociology - Answer- applying sociology for the public good; especially
sociological perspective (how things relate to one another) to guide politicians and
policy makers
Theory - Answer- general statement about how some parts of the world fit together and
how they work; an explanation of how 2 or more facts are related to one another
